Jerrilyn's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Jerrilyn splits its recorded history at 1968: 23% of all births land in the more recent half, 77% in the earlier half, leaning more toward its earlier era than today's. The single quietest year was 1936 (5 births) -- compare that against the 1942 peak of 86 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Jerrilyn?
1,277 babies have been named Jerrilyn since 1936. All-time, it sits at #6,362 of 72,339 girls' names by recorded births. It was last recorded in 2011. The peak year was 1942 with 86 births.

When was Jerrilyn most popular?
Jerrilyn was most popular in the 1940s decade with 451 total births. The single peak year was 1942.
Where is Jerrilyn most popular?
The top states for the name Jerrilyn are New York (58 births), California (56 births), Pennsylvania (20 births).
How long has the name Jerrilyn been used?
Jerrilyn has been recorded in Social Security data since 1936, spanning 76 years of data through 2011.
